The scope of legal protection for listed buildings

This List entry helps identify the building designated at this address for its special architectural or historic interest.

Unless the List entry states otherwise, it includes both the structure itself and any object or structure fixed to it (whether inside or outside) as well as any object or structure within the curtilage of the building.

For these purposes, to be included within the curtilage of the building, the object or structure must have formed part of the land since before 1st July 1948.

Details

TM 16 NE
4/85

THORNDON
HESTLEY GREEN
Green Farmhouse

II

Farmhouse. Early C17, the cross-wing perhaps earlier. A 3-cell main range
with service cross-wing to west. Timber framed, mostly plastered, part of
service wing faced or rebuilt in colourwashed brick. Thatched roof. 2
storeys, attic in parlour cell only. North face of main range has mainly C19
casement windows and a mid C20 entrance addition with side door. To the
south, mainly mid C20 standard casements and a small gabled porch. Large
single-pane window in east gable end (facing road). Service wing has various
openings; one slatted window in north gable end. Each range has an internal
stack with rendered shaft. Modernised interior. Plain joists, set flat, in
ground floor rooms. Altered newel stair. Main members of frame visible on
upper floor but no studding. Cambered tie beam over hall chamber. Roof of
very regular form: clasped purlins, almost straight wind braces in end bays
only. Service wing much altered, especially on ground floor; stack is a later
insertion. Clasped purlin roof with a few re-used medieval rafters.
